Abstract

The demand for optimal esthetics has increased with the advent of the implant dentistry. It answers many questions concerning esthetics, like replacement of hopeless teeth in esthetic zone of maxillary arch. Now a days immediate restoration of a single tooth loss by implant supported prosthesis is highly predictable treatment.
This clinical report describes a protocol of an immediate tooth extraction, followed by placement of provisional denture in the prepared socket of maxillary central incisors. Surgical and restorative techniques are prescribed in the text. A review program of 3, 6, and 12 months was followed.
